Business Atlas and Shippers' Guide (1895)
Published by Rand McNally & Co.

A note taken from the Shipper's Guide for Huntsville:
Services available in 1895: had a Post Office, a Railroad Station, an Express Office

List of Post Offices in the United States (1870)
Published by the Government Printing Office

Huntsville was listed as Huntsville Courthouse.

Table of U.S. Post Offices in the United States (Jan. 1851)
Published by W. & J.C. Greer, Printers

Huntsville was listed as Huntsville Courthouse.

U.S. Post Offices (Oct. 1846)
Published by John T. Towers

Huntsville was listed as Huntsville Courthouse.
